DESCRIPTION:Serious action on climate change has been stalled in the U.S. for a number of reasons, but perhaps the most salient is the longstanding lack of public acceptance of well-established climate science. How can we address that?\n\nWe are joined this week by Matthew Slater, the John Howard Harris Professor of Philosophy at Bucknell University.
